Starbucks has two things that are essential for every bloggers’ life…caffeine and wi-fi. Grabbing a venti cup of heaven and sitting down to get some work done is always easy to do here. Sometimes we encounter hotels that have very slow internet service or ::gasp:: hotels that charge for wi-fi access, and then our best option is to find the nearest Starbucks and set up shop. We seem to do this often enough where we have managed to acquire a gold card so refills on regular brewed coffee are free and we earn free treats every couple of purchases as well. I’d rather pay three bucks for a cup of coffee and free, fast wi-fi than pay ten bucks at a hotel for wi-fi that is slow and disconnects me every twenty minutes.
